基于网络环境的高校勤工俭学管理系统设计.docVIP

  • 32
  • 0
  • 约4.44千字
  • 约 8页
  • 2016-12-10 发布于北京
  • 举报

基于网络环境的高校勤工俭学管理系统设计.doc

基于网络环境的高校勤工俭学管理系统设计   摘 要:勤工俭学一直以来为各高校一些学生提供了工作机会,并能够减轻其家庭的经济负担。随着互联网的发展,为提高高校勤工俭学效率,实现系统化、规范化和自动化,本文尝试基于网络建立起一套学生工作效果的评估机制,同时对于解决学校工勤人力资源的不足,进而提高学校综合管理质量和水平,有着积极的现实意义。   关键词:勤工俭学;管理系统;系统设计   中图分类号:G647 文献标志码:A 文章编号:1673-8454(2016)09-0050-03   一、引言   勤工俭学是指在校学生在学校的组织指导下,利用课余时间或假期在校内外通过劳动取得的合理报酬的一种社会实践活动。 它不仅能够减轻贫困家庭经济负担,还能够促进学生的全面发展,提高学生的综合素质。为实现高校勤工俭学工作的系统化、规范化和自动化,需要在完善有关勤工俭学管理的各项规章制度上,重视勤工俭学管理工作的信息化建设,以此来保障勤工俭学工作的全面推进。本文尝试建立起一套学生工作效果的评估机制,对解决学校工勤人力资源的不足,进而提高学校综合管理质量和水平,有着积极的现实意义。   二、技术支持   本网站开发使用java语言。项目使用的框架是spring+springMVC+mybatis。之所以使用springMVC,因为它比struts2效率高,最主要是因为struts2有好多的漏洞,容易受到黑客的攻击,同时它可以集成freemark和json数据,为以后更好的扩张做准备。Mybatis是一个数据持久化层,通过它完成数据的存储。使用它的原因是:它能很好地防止sql注入,不需要人为的防止,而且可以手动编写sql语句,很灵活,最主要是效率高。   展示层使用html5。现在好多的浏览器都支持html5,兼容性很好。而且它有好多的新标签,可减少工作量。同时现在移动端对html5的支持也是很好的。现在有很多项目的微信开发和app开发都是用html5。所以为以后手机端的开发做准备。甚至不需要再次开发,通过简单的包装就能完成移动端的开发。   数据库使用mysql和mogoDB。Mysql是关系型数据库,网站上主要的信息都在上面存放。mogoDB存放一些不是很重要的信息,比如一些日志、评价等。   数据的检索使用solr。现在主流的检索工具很少,luence全文检索比较成熟。Solr现在也很成熟,它是基于luence的,检索效率相当高。在百万级的查询条件下只需要几秒的时间,如果是直接查询数据库,数据库可能就宕机了。它还有高亮等一些特效。使用它可以增加用户的体验效果。   后台开发的管理员页面使用easyUI的框架。它的开发效率很快,它封装了好多插件,程序员能够高效写出很好的页面,而且它的界面也很好看。   三、系统需求分析   1.系统总体需求   研究生勤工俭学管理系统是先进的计算机科学技术和现代招聘理念相结合的产物,通过使用此系统,满足了在校求职者和招聘企业双向的要求,同时也能够减轻一些贫困家庭的经济困难,有利于培养研究生的创新能力、实践能力以及综合素质。但是现在关于勤工俭学助学的申请,大部分高校依然采用人工管理,由于涉及大量表格的整理和备份,加上工时工资计算,导致效率较低,而且错误率极大。为了改变这一现状,本研究致力于实现勤工俭学系统的计算机信息化、智能化的管理和相关数据计算。   根据现有系统存在的各种弊端和问题,本文设计并实现的硕士勤工俭学管理系统希望能够达到以下目标:   (1)外观界面   总结现有勤工俭学系统外观的优点,界面直观,操作简单,避免了因为用户误操作等可能而导致输入的数据出现错误,使界面具有了较强的容错功能。   (2)业务方式   我们改进的系统将会改变原有的以勤工俭学为主的模式,而将更多的职责和业务方式交给硕士学生和用工单位,让我们的新系统更加高效实用地运行。   (3)功能应用   本文设计并实现的硕士勤工俭学系统符合校方学生管理体制,具有相应接口,能对校内学籍管理等系统进行数据对接;同时系统操作界面应简单明了,具有信息发布、关键事件提醒等人性化功能。   2.功能性需求分析   系统功能主要包含以下几个模块:(见图1)   (1)参数设置与信息查询模块。参数设置这一功能,能实现岗位开放和结束申请的时间、岗位申请对象当中贫苦生的比例等。设置完成点击保存之后,就完成了学生对岗位申请相关要求的限制。信息查询有学生信息查询、岗位信息查询、岗位分配查询、学生评估查询、工资表查询。这个模块尽可能为学生提供重要的信息,让学生一目了然。   (2)申请模块。岗位发布包括岗位信息发布和岗位信息查询,岗位信息发布时需要录入以下内容:校区、岗位名称、性质、申请人、工作开始日期、工作

文档评论(0)

1亿VIP精品文档

相关文档